WHEREAS, The Commissioner of Parks, Playgro$nds and Public Buildings has
reported, in accordance with Section 53 of the City Charter, the
existence of an emergency daring the period from July 1 to 15,
1956, which rendered necessary the employment of certain employees
of the Department of Parks, playgrounds and Public Buildings for
more than eight hours per day or forty hours per week in doing the
following work:
Supervision, care, maintenance and protection of public
parks and playgrounds and of their facilities.
And WHEREAS, This emergency arose by reason of the following facts and
circumstances:
Seasonal requirements for protection of public property
and pursuit of departmental activities, such as: Municipal
golf, baseball and softball; the many facilities for
public picnics and programs; the Zoo, Greenhouse and parks
refectories; Phalen Beach and Highland Pool; all of which
have heavier patronage on week ends and holidays.
TH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, That the proper city officers are hereby
authorized to pay the employees who performed such work in accord-
ance with the provisions of the Council's salary ordinance,
Ordinance No. 6) 46.
